Troubleshooting Common Issues in Sheet Metal Laser Cutting

Addressing frequent challenges in sheet metal laser machining often necessitates a organized method. Consider on gap measurement inaccuracies, leading from damaged nozzles or incorrect beam intensity settings. Angled edges can suggest difficulties with lens placement or stock thickness differences. Furthermore, frequent fringe suggest inadequate air flow or severing speed being too fast. Finally, verify equipment calibration and remove debris regularly to minimize stoppage.
